Understanding Arlo’s Battle Mechanics

Arlo is a member of Team GO Rocket, and he is known for his strategic use of certain Pokémon during battles. Knowing his lineup can help you prepare effectively. Arlo frequently changes his Pokémon, but his typical choices include a mix of Dark, Steel, and Flying types like Scizor, Salamence, and Gyarados. Each Pokémon has its strengths and weaknesses, so understanding these can significantly improve your chances of winning.

Preparing Your Team

To beat Arlo Pokémon Go, you need to build a team that can counter his common Pokémon types. Here are some recommendations:

  • Counter Pokémon for Scizor: Scizor, being a Bug and Steel type, is weak to Fire, Fighting, and Ground. Pokémon like Blaziken (Fire/Fighting) or Garchomp (Ground) would be excellent choices.
  • Strategies Against Salamence: Salamence is a Dragon and Flying type. Ice-type moves are super effective against it, so having Pokémon like Mamoswine (Ice/Ground) or Weavile (Ice/Dark) can give you an edge.
  • How to Deal with Gyarados: Gyarados is a Water and Flying type. Electric-type Pokémon like Raikou or Luxray can exploit its weaknesses effectively.

Optimal Move Sets

In addition to selecting the right Pokémon, having the optimal move sets is crucial. When preparing your team to beat Arlo Pokémon Go, consider the following:

  • For Fire-type Pokémon, moves like Fire Spin or Blast Burn can deal significant damage to Scizor.
  • Ice-type Pokémon should utilize moves such as Ice Shard or Avalanche to maximize their effectiveness against Salamence.
  • Electric-type Pokémon should focus on moves like Volt Switch or Thunderbolt to bring down Gyarados quickly.

Battle Strategy

Once you’ve assembled your team and chosen your moves, it’s time to dive into battle. Here are some strategies to keep in mind when you face Arlo:

  • Lead with Strength: Start strong with a Pokémon that has a type advantage against Arlo’s lead Pokémon. This can give you an initial boost and set the tone for the rest of the battle.
  • Timing Your Shields: Don’t forget to use your shields wisely. Anticipate Arlo’s charged moves and shield against the most damaging attacks. Be strategic—using shields too early can leave you vulnerable later in the battle.
  • Switching Pokémon: If one of your Pokémon is at a disadvantage, don’t hesitate to switch out. Knowing when to switch can turn the tide in your favor.
